接入本地大模型工作流程是指在计算机系统中,将一个大型的机器学习模型部署到本地环境中,以便在本地设备上进行训练、推理和预测等操作。这个过程通常包括以下几个步骤:
1. 准备数据:首先需要收集和整理大量的训练数据,这些数据应该具有代表性和多样性,以便模型能够学习到各种特征和模式。
2. 选择模型:根据任务需求选择合适的机器学习模型,例如神经网络、决策树、支持向量机等。这些模型可以是预先训练好的,也可以是自定义的。
3. 配置环境:搭建本地开发环境,安装必要的编程语言、库和框架。例如,可以使用Python、R、Java等语言,以及TensorFlow、PyTorch、Scikit-learn等库。
4. 编写代码:根据所选模型和数据,编写相应的代码来实现模型的训练、评估和预测等功能。这可能涉及到数据处理、特征工程、模型训练、参数调优等步骤。
5. 训练模型:使用准备好的数据对模型进行训练,通过调整模型参数来优化模型的性能。这个过程可能需要多次迭代,直到达到满意的效果。
6. 测试和验证:在训练完成后,使用独立的测试数据集对模型进行评估和验证,以确保模型的准确性和泛化能力。
7. 部署模型:将训练好的模型部署到生产环境中,以便在实际场景中进行预测和决策。这可能涉及到将模型转换为可执行文件、优化模型性能、处理实时数据等步骤。
8. 监控和优化:在部署过程中,需要持续监控模型的性能和稳定性,并根据实际需求进行调整和优化。这可能涉及到定期更新模型、修复bug、优化算法等操作。
总之,接入本地大模型工作流程是一个涉及数据准备、模型选择、环境搭建、代码编写、训练、验证、部署和监控等多个环节的过程。通过这个流程,可以有效地将大型机器学习模型应用到实际场景中,提高系统的性能和可靠性。